Characterization of norm-attaining operator pairs

Characterize all pairs of Banach spaces $(X,Y)$ for which the set of norm-attaining bounded linear operators from $X$ into $Y$ is dense in the space of bounded linear operators $L(X,Y)$.

Background

The paper places its Lipschitz minimum-attainment problem in the broader context of the Bishop–Phelps theory for norm-attaining operators. Although norm-attaining functionals can be densely approximated, norm-attaining operators need not be dense in general. A complete geometric characterization of the domain–range pairs for which density holds remains unresolved.
